#author("2016-09-30T11:38:08+09:00","default:nari","nari") #author("2016-09-30T11:42:33+09:00","default:nari","nari") [[FrontPage]] * HSES-LCD24 技術情報 [#c823df5c] ** 回路 [#x809e838] - ESP-WROOM-02側 基板 回路図: &ref(v320c1.pdf); - LCDモジュール 回路図: &ref(2.4inch1.pdf);, 寸法:&ref(2.4inch.pdf); -- LCD Controller: ILI9341, TochPanelIF: [[XPT2046:https://ldm-systems.ru/f/doc/catalog/HY-TFT-2,8/XPT2046.pdf]] - IO -- SPI: SCK-IO14, MISO-IO12, MOSI-IO13 -- LCD: CS-IO2, D/C-IO15 -- TouchPanel: CS-IO16, IRQ-IO4((SP1をショートで接続されるがI2Cを使用できなくなる,IRQを接続しなくてもTouchPanelは使用可能)) -- SDcard: CS-IO0 -- I2C: ((コネクタは未実装。ピン配置はWireライブラリのデフォルトと同じ)) SDA-IO4((SP1ショート時は使用できない)), SCL-IO5 - 未実装コネクタ -- I2C: [[GROVE - ユニバーサル4ピンコネクタ(10個入りパック):https://www.switch-science.com/catalog/1122/]]を取り付け可能です。GROVEデバイスのI2C接続のものを使用可能(?) 未保証です。 対応商品発売予定 -- USB(垂直): [[ミニUSBコネクタ(B):http://www.aitendo.com/product/4391]]を取り付け可能です。設置場所、ケーブルの取り回しで、こちらのほうが都合が良い場合おつかいください。2つのUSBコネクタに同時にケーブルを接続、通電しないでください。 ** 開発環境: ESP8266 Arduino [#r46b677b] HSES-LCDのプログラムはArduinoを使用して行うことが出来ます。 WiFi, LCD,TouchPanel,SDCardのライブラリがあります。 - [[ESP8266 Arduinoのインストール]] - Arduinoでの設定 -- ボード: Generic ESP8266 Module -- ResetMethod: nodemcu -- シリアルポート: 認識されたFT231Xのポート - [[GitHub - esp8266/Arduino: ESP8266 core for Arduino:https://github.com/esp8266/Arduino]] -- [[リファレンス:https://github.com/esp8266/Arduino/blob/master/doc/reference.md]] -- [[ライブラリ:https://github.com/esp8266/Arduino/blob/master/doc/libraries.md]] - [[HSES-LCD24の各機能用Arduinoライブラリ]] ** 公開しているライブラリ・アプリケーション [#fadf771c] - [[NetLCD:https://github.com/h-nari/NetLCD/blob/master/readme_ja.md]]: アプリケーション, HSES-LCD24をネットワーク経由で使用できるLCDディスプレイにする - [[Humblesoft_ILI9341:https://github.com/h-nari/Humblesoft_ILI9341]] ライブラリ、LCDに線、文字等を描画、Adafruit_ILI9341を拡張し、日本語描画機能を追加 - [[LcdTouchscreen:https://github.com/h-nari/LcdTouchscreen]] タッチスクリーンのライブラリ、キャリブレーション機能有り ** 関連ブログ記事 [#wf0fcf11] - [[HSES-LCD24に文字を表示するプログラム(1) | うだうだブログ:http://www.narimatsu.net/blog/?p=10636]] - [[HSES-LCD24に文字を表示させるプログラム(2) | うだうだブログ:http://www.narimatsu.net/blog/?p=10666]] - [[HSES-LCD24に文字を表示させるプログラム(3) | うだうだブログ:http://www.narimatsu.net/blog/?p=10685]] - [[HSES-LCD24に文字を表示させる(4) 画像表示とNetLCD公開 | うだうだブログ:http://www.narimatsu.net/blog/?p=10705]] - [[Adafruit_ILI9341に漢字表示機能追加 | うだうだブログ:http://www.narimatsu.net/blog/?p=10739]] - [[生活に小型ディスプレーを!! | うだうだブログ:http://www.narimatsu.net/blog/?p=10749]] - [[HSES-LCD24のタッチスクリーンを使う | うだうだブログ:http://www.narimatsu.net/blog/?p=10776]]